Instalación de Docker en la Raspberry Pi u Otros

Docker es una herramienta increíblemente poderosa que proporciona virtualización a nivel de sistema operativo para entregar paquetes de software dentro de contenedores.

Estar en un contenedor significa que el software no puede acceder a nada que el tiempo de ejecución de Docker no le entregue; Esto puede ayudar con la seguridad y la administración de recursos.

Docker te permite desplegar tu software en dispositivos sin esfuerzo, ya que todo está incluido en el contenedor que descarga el ejecutor.

Lo mejor de todo es que Docker hace todo esto manteniendo una sobrecarga muy baja. Tener una sobrecarga baja permite que el software se ejecute en una máquina de recursos limitados como la Raspberry Pi.

A continuación, lo guiaremos a través del proceso de instalación de Docker en su Raspberry Pi, además de mostrarle cómo probar si funciona correctamente.

Recomendado

Nuestra primera tarea es actualizar todos nuestros paquetes existentes antes de proceder a instalar Docker.

Podemos actualizar todos los paquetes existentes ejecutando los siguientes dos comandos en Raspberry Pi.

sudo apt update && sudo apt upgrade upgrade

2.Con nuestra Raspberry Pi completamente actualizada, ahora podemos continuar e instalar Docker en Raspberry Pi.

Afortunadamente para nosotros, Docker ha hecho que este proceso sea increíblemente rápido y sencillo al proporcionar un script bash que instala todo por usted.

Puede descargar y ejecutar el script de instalación oficial de Docker ejecutando el siguiente comando.

curl -sSL https://get.docker.com | sh
 

Este comando canalizará el script directamente a la línea de comando. Normalmente sería mejor si no hiciera esto; sin embargo, Docker es una fuente confiable.

Si no está seguro de ejecutar esto directamente sin inspeccionarlo primero, puede ir directamente a get.docker.com para ver el script.

Este script puede tardar algún tiempo en completarse, ya que detecta e instala automáticamente todo lo que necesita para ejecutar Docker en Raspberry Pi.

Configurando su usuario para Docker

Necesitamos hacer un ligero ajuste a nuestro usuario antes de que podamos comenzar a usar Docker sin problemas.

Esto tiene que ver con la forma en que funciona el sistema de permisos de Linux con Docker. De forma predeterminada, solo el usuario de Docker puede interactuar con Docker, pero hay una manera de solucionar este problema.

1.Una vez que Docker haya terminado de instalarse en su Raspberry Pi, hay un par de cosas más que debemos hacer.

 

Para que otro usuario pueda interactuar con Docker, es necesario agregarlo al docker grupo.

Entonces, nuestro siguiente paso es agregar nuestro usuario actual al docker grupo usando el comando usermod como se muestra a continuación. Al usar » $USER» estamos insertando la variable de entorno que almacena el nombre de los usuarios actuales.

sudo usermod -aG docker $USER

Si no agregamos nuestro usuario al grupo, no podremos interactuar con Docker sin ejecutarlo como usuario root.

2.Dado que realizamos algunos cambios en nuestro usuario, ahora necesitaremos cerrar sesión y volver a iniciarla para que surta efecto.

Puede cerrar sesión ejecutando el siguiente comando en la terminal.

logout
 

3.Una vez que haya vuelto a iniciar sesión, puede verificar que el grupo de Docker se haya agregado correctamente a su usuario ejecutando el siguiente comando.

groups

Este comando enumerará todos los grupos de los que forma parte el usuario actual. Si todo funcionó como debería, el grupo docker debería aparecer aquí.

Probando la instalación de Docker en Raspberry Pi

Con Docker ahora configurado en nuestra Raspberry Pi, debemos continuar y probar para asegurarnos de que esté funcionando.

1.Para probar si Docker está funcionando, continuaremos y ejecutaremos el siguiente comando en nuestro Pi.

Este comando le indicará a Docker que descargue, configure y ejecute un contenedor acoplable llamado » hello-world» .

 
docker run hello-world

2.Si ha instalado correctamente Docker en su Raspberry Pi, debería ver un mensaje con el siguiente texto.

Hello from Docker!
This message shows that your installation appears to be working correctly.

Instalación de Docker en Raspberry Pi – Pi My Life Up


Categories:


Comments

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Este sitio web utiliza cookies para que usted tenga la mejor experiencia de usuario. Si continúa navegando está dando su consentimiento para la aceptación de las mencionadas cookies y la aceptación de nuestra política de cookies, pinche el enlace para mayor información.plugin cookies

ACEPTAR
Aviso de cookies